Job Opening for Senior Solution Architect
This permanent role is based in Dublin, Ireland.
About the Role
We are seeking an experienced Solutions Architect with hands-on .Net Development or Java experience. The ideal candidate will also have experience developing Cloud PaaS applications.
You will work with various clients from global scale to SMEs, utilizing cutting-edge technologies and collaborating with an experienced team of Architects.
Key Responsibilities
* Define, architect, and design solutions tailored to meet customer project requirements.
* Conduct client discovery workshops, gather and document requirements.
* Assume a trusted advisor role, steering customers towards solutions with the highest potential for sustained success.
* Establish and steer technical vision and strategy, offering insightful thought leadership.
* Collaborate closely with Project Managers and Scrum Masters to ensure deliverables align with business benefits and adhere to established standards, policies, and design conventions.
* Cultivate relationships with IT stakeholders at client organizations, aiding their comprehension of how Microsoft technology solutions (Cloud-hosted .Net Applications/Power Platform/Dataverse) integrate into their overarching technology strategy.
* Grasp the fundamentals of Microservice Architecture.
* Exhibit understanding and hands-on experience in Event-Driven Architecture.
* Deepen your expertise in the Microsoft ecosystem through practical training and exploration across customization, integration, and service delivery domains.
* Collaborate with external vendors covering all IT aspects, spanning Architecture, Development, Testing, and Support, ensuring optimal delivery while upholding quality benchmarks.
Required Skills
* Proficient coding background in languages such as C#,, and .NET Core.
* Considerable familiarity with web technologies, including TypeScript, JavaScript & jQuery, as well as HTML5, among others.
* Significant proficiency in creating and querying Web APIs (REST, XML, JSON) and Web Services.
* Evidenced skill in conceptualizing and crafting solutions through on Microsoft platform technologies, encompassing .Net Applications, Dynamics CRM (On-prem & D365), Power Platform/Dataverse, and Power Automate.
* Demonstrated grasp of data integration and migrating applications to Cloud environments.
* In-depth comprehension of Microsoft or Open-Source stack products, paired with expertise in enterprise digital identity and security.
* Robust familiarity with CI/CD processes, utilizing tools like Azure DevOps (Boards, Repos, Pipelines) or Jenkins, etc.
* Insight into diverse cloud architectures and strategies (public, private, and hybrid).
* Sound skills in Database Design & Database querying. Nice to have
* Experience with Azure cloud services, PaaS, Batch Services, Microservices Architecture, and Serverless approaches is beneficial
* Bonus points for experience in application development for CRM or ERP systems.